We were fortunate to have beautiful and cool (for us) weather during our visit to Oregon. Which made us want to spend as much time as possible outside. And what could be better than a trip to the Oregon Gardens in Silverton.

The gardens included wetlands (using reclaimed water), prairie grass, oak trees older that were here before the founding of our country, lots of gazebos, and they even had an arid greenhouse with cacti.
